Three‐Dimensionally Ordered Mesoporous Molecular‐Sieve Films as Solid Superacid Photocatalysts

Xinchen Wang、Jimmy C. Yu、Yidong Hou 等 4 位作者2005-01-06Advanced Materials

Mesoporous solid superacid molecular sieve films have been prepared (see Figure) and used as photocatalysts. The new class of superacid possesses large surface area, uniform pore size, and accessible 3D mesoporous architecture. These are attractive properties for catalytic or photocatalytic applications.
